Florida Evans (later Florida Evans-Dixon) is the protagonist of Good Times in Seasons 1-4 and 6. She is the mother of J.J., Thelma, and Michael Evans, and the widow of James Evans and Carl Dixon after the untimely death of James, who died in a automobile accident while preparing his family to move to Mississippi. Unfortunately, he died on 19 April 1986 at the age of 78. 5. Ben Powers. Ben Powers as Keith Anderson in Good Times. Photo: CBS. Source: Getty Images. Ben Powers played Keith Anderson, the husband of Thelma Evans, during the sixth and final season of Good Times.
